
Description
Welcome to 626 High St, she is just adorable. The hardwood floors throughout this 3 level home have withstood the test of time and are gorgeous! You immediately feel at home! Lovely fixtures, which are probably original to this home add to the charm. The dining room is very generous in size. The main level has an office, powder room, a nice kitchen with an eat in breakfast bar. There are four bedrooms, and 1.5 baths all total. This home has been a rental for a few years, but the owners have maintained it very well. There are just a couple of tweaks to be made, and the owners are working on that as well. The owner has explored the possibility of a possible building lot on the Lynchburg side. There may be a possibility of that with local zoning approval. Nothing is set in stone, but the new owner could explore further, if desired. In the historic district, four blocks to downtown, but close to Chestertown's Rail for Trails, which is a nice, paved path through Chestertown. Enjoy Washington College and all it has to offer to the community, local restaurants, a thriving artists community, music, the farmer's market, artisans, charming shops, and friendly welcoming people! There is a health food store, coffee shops, two grocery stores, hardware store, a local golf course at Chester River Yacht and County Club, bocci and pickle ball teams you can join! Like to kayak and canoe? You can easily do both on the Chester River, or Radcliffe Creek.
